It is a cement-based, single-component, polymer-added powder mortar with extra features, with reduced slip properties and a long working time, used for bonding tiles and ceramics.
Usage areas:
•Indoors and outdoors.
•On horizontal and vertical surfaces.
It is used for bonding small and medium sized floor and wall ceramics and similar materials with a water absorption rate of over 3% .
Advantages:
•Easy to apply.
•Processing time is long, saving time and labor.
•It allows the glued plates to be corrected for a long time.
•It is resistant to water and frost.
•Provides high stability and does not sag in vertical applications.
Preparation of the Surface:
•Make sure that the application surface is cured.
•The application surface must be clean of anti-adhesion substances such as dust, oil, tar, pitch, paint, silicone, curing material, detergent and mold oils.
•Defects on the application surface should be corrected with suitable DEMAFIX repair mortars 24 hours before, depending on the depth and structure of the surface.
•The application surface should be wetted and kept moist. If the surface is very water absorbent, application should be made after applying a primer to the surface.
•In wet area applications, before using ceramic adhesive, waterproofing should be done with DEMAFIX's suitable waterproofing materials.
Preparation of Mortar:
•25 kg DEMAFIX Tile and Ceramic Adhesive Mortar is added to approximately 6 - 7 liters of clean water and mixed preferably with a low speed mixer until there are no lumps.
•The prepared mortar is left to mature for 5 - 10 minutes and used again by mixing for 1 - 2 minutes.
•The mixture in the container should be consumed within 2.5 - 3 hours.
Application Information:
•First of all, a contact layer is formed by pressing the adhesive mortar strongly onto the application surface, and then the product is notched with a notched trowel selected according to the size of the tile.

•Depending on the floor slabs used and the smoothness of the floor, if necessary, a double-sided bonding method should be preferred and adhesive mortar should be applied to both the back of the ceramic and the surface, and the slabs should be fixed so that the combing direction is perpendicular to each other.
•To ensure good adhesion, the ceramic must be adhered to the surface by applying force with a rubber-tipped mallet.
•To ensure stronger adhesion in outdoor applications, application should be made by mixing it with a sufficient amount of DEMAFIX LATEX or DEMAFIX DOUBLE COMPONENT INSULATION MATERIAL Component B.
•The application should be completed by leaving a joint space compatible with the ceramic size and using the appropriate DEMAFIX joint filler material.
Consumption:
3.5 - 4 kg/m2
Attention:
•Avoid application at temperatures below +5°C and above +35°C.
•Pay attention to the amount of water added to the mortar. Do not add more water than necessary.
•Avoid application in areas that are frozen, at risk of freezing within 24 hours, or exposed to direct sun and wind.
•Never add water or powder to expired mortar.
